Simple activation work to prep GKs for various actions.
Notably, get in a warmup of movement prior to activation
1) GK side on, server calls Turn, GK turns square to server for volley - Reps as desired
2) GK double-tap footwork over line/hurdle/cone then set for volley - Reps as desired
3) Spread save position for volley - stretch out hips and hamstrings - Reps as desired
4) Butt-Knees-Feet - get used to hitting the ground - Reps as desired
CPs: Build in pace as we go along, touching on footwork/handling/spread shape/diving, technique is important
Coach Note: College GKs especially for this activation routine.

Ryan Coulter - GK Nexus
One mannequin - two cones, approx. 4 yards apart behind mannequin.
GK moves laterally from one cone to the other behind the mannequin
Shuffle around opposite cone
Explode in front of mannequin (but close) to encourage staying forward in set
Volley to hands (can change service as necessary)
Repeat to opposite side
Variations - start with bounced ball to hands, start with distribution from feet
CPs: Quick and sharp footwork, positive set position, clean hands

Ryan Coulter - GK Nexus
One mannequin - two cones, approx. 4 yards apart behind mannequin.
GK receives volley (or other service) from initial set position
GK moves laterally from one cone to the other behind the mannequin
Shuffle around opposite cone
Adjust body shape and dive in front of mannequin (encourage forward dive)
Repeat to opposite side
Variations - start with bounced ball to hands, start with distribution from feet
CPs: Quick and sharp footwork, positive set position, clean hands, forward dive angles

Progression from just footwork to including the ball.
1 - GK footwork -- drop, cross, step to shuffle -- from top cone to first
- GK sets and receives volley
2 - From set position, side server tosses ball deep over head of GK
- GK footwork -- drop, cross, step, explode -- to make contact with ball (catch/tip/stretch)
- use top hand

GK trains to tip a shot / service over the crossbar
GK starts in middle of goal - shuffles out to touch pole
- server on that side tosses or vollies ball over GK
- GK footwork (drop, cross, step, explode) to tip over the crossbar -- use top hand
REPEAT TO ALL POLES - MULTIPLE REPS IF NECESSARY

Four Square (10 mins)
Fun warmup exercise
Goal is to progress to 4th box.
Ball can only bounce one time in your box, bounces twice = you're out and group moves up
Must bat ball with hand - no catching/throwing - must hit another player's box
- if hits your own box or goes out of bounds, you are out and group moves up
Can play with just feet (ie: no hands)
CPs: Fun competitive game, works on reactions
